Manama, The Central Bank of Bahrain (CBB) announces that the monthly issue of the Sukuk Al Salam Islamic securities has been Fully Subscribed by 100%. Subscriptions worth BD 43 million were received for the BD 43 million issue, which carries a maturity of 91 days. The expected return on the issue, which begins on July 10 and matures on October 9, is 6.06% compared to 5.92% for the previous issue on June 12. The Sukuk Al Salam is issued by the CBB on behalf of the Government of the Kingdom of Bahrain. This is issue No.279 (BH000N45A384) of the short-term Sukuk Al Salam series. Source: Bahrain News Agency
